Collect for the day:
Almighty God, you show to those who are in error the light of your truth, that they may return to the way of righteousness: grant to all those who are admitted into the fellowship of Christ’s religion, that they may reject those things that are contrary to their profession, and follow all such things as are agreeable to the same; through our Lord Jesus Christ, who is alive and reigns with you, in the unity of the Holy Spirit, one God, now and for ever. Amen.
Post-Communion prayer:
Heavenly Father, as we celebrate this year of mercy: open the doors of our hearts and minds that we may show forth in our lives the mercy and compassion that we see in the face of your Son Jesus Christ who is alive and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it one God forever and ever. Amen.

Domestic Abuse: Following on from last Sunday’s sermon, literature is now placed suitably around the Church and Church Centre and one or two contact numbers below. If you want to speak further about the issues raised do approach Mark or Jo. If you would like to get more involved in raising awareness of domestic abuse then please speak to Mark – we hope to have perhaps a small group with a named church rep.
Worth Domestic Abuse Advisors: 0330 222818, 01903 205111 ext 84395 or 07834 968539 (weekends). WORTH Services is an Independent Domestic (IDVA) Service here to support people affected by domestic abuse in West Sussex. Available 7 days a week 0900-1700hrs on the telephone numbers above.
